When it comes to facilities, Borough Green & Wrotham train station has got you covered. Ticketing is straightforward, with a ticket office open during most of the week, complemented by user-friendly ticket machines. If you've purchased your tickets online, collection is a breeze from these machines located within the station forecourt. For those who utilize technology, smartcards can be issued here, although you'll need to validate them elsewhere.
Supporting passengers with additional needs is also a priority, with partially step-free access to platforms and an accessible ticket machine available at the station forecourt. Information is freely accessible from both staff and help points, ensuring every traveler feels supported on their journey. Staff assistance is available during most daytime hours, with a dedicated helpline to provide navigation help throughout the station. Amenities such as toilets, including accessible types, are open during station staffing hours ensuring a comfortable wait for your train.
As part of the Southeastern rail network, Borough Green & Wrotham offers a wide array of connections, both by train and by other means. The station is equipped with cycle storage for those preferring to pedal to this commute point, offering shelters to keep bicycles dry, though users take responsibility for their bikes' security.
Bus services connect directly via a stop at the Station Approach Road. For onward travel, a taxi rank is conveniently located at the front of the station, making it easier to continue your journey without hassle. While modest in size, Theobalds Grove station is equipped with essential amenities designed to help you navigate your journey with ease. Although it lacks an on-site ticket office, automated ticket machines are provided for you to purchase or collect pre-booked tickets effortlessly. The station supports accessible ticketing facilities, offering an induction loop for those with hearing impairments.
For individuals requiring assistance, the station staff is available from the early hours of the morning to late at night. Passenger information can be accessed through departure and arrival screens and regular announcements, ensuring that you stay informed about your train's status or any service updates.
Theobalds Grove prioritizes accessibility, albeit offering limited step-free access. The station lacks fully accessible platforms, but it does feature three parking spaces specifically for accessible vehicles. There’s no waiting room or toilets, yet passengers can find refuge in the available seating areas. Additionally, vending machines offer refreshments to keep travelers refreshed during their journey.
Well-connected to various transport modes, Theobalds Grove station simplifies onward travel with local bus services stopping directly at the station. Both northbound services towards Cheshunt and southbound routes to Seven Sisters or Liverpool Street are easily accessible from nearby bus stops. These robust connections facilitate effortless transit within and beyond the local and Greater London area.
